An incredible journey that stays on your mind

The drama starts off quite lightly; it is fast-paced and has a very entertaining action-comedy kind of vibe. However, after a few episodes, it becomes slower, more serious, darker, suspenseful, and mysterious—keeping that tone for the better part of the remaining story. But there is nothing to fear, because, oh, what an incredible journey and an emotional rollercoaster it is! ✨

Ding Yuxi and Zhang Xincheng play their roles brilliantly. This was the first time I had seen Xincheng on my screen, and I was really impressed by his acting. However, Yuxi showed sides of his talent I hadn't seen before in any of his other works. His performance took my breath away and made me sit on the edge of my seat for the better half of the story. The main characters don't have any romance, if anyone is looking for that, but they do share a brotherly love, and that love is one of a kind. I was incredibly invested in both of their characters and still can't get them out of my head or move on. This is how big of an impact this drama—especially Yuxi and Xincheng's characters—left on me. 🥺❤️

I would highly recommend this to anyone. Even though it had a few flaws, just like any other drama, it is still a complete 10/10 from me. 🌟🏆
